Cardross to Newark Northgate Train Journey Information
Experience seamless journey planning from Cardross to Newark Northgate. Explore the earliest and latest train times, departure and arrival stations, distance, journey time, and pricing options to optimise your trip.
First train | 07:02 |
---|---|
Last train | 23:40 |
Departure station | Cardross |
Arrival station | Newark Northgate |
Distance | 252 miles |
Journey time | From 5h 10m |
Price | From £74.33 |
Train operators | ScotRail, LNER |

Book Cheap Train Tickets
Train tickets from Cardross to Newark North Gate are available with Split Ticket and Advance tickets. The average fare is around £0.00, while the cheapest fare is £35.00. Besides, you can book cheap tickets on off-peak time, which usually begin at 09:30.(Intercity Off-Peak times: Monday to Friday from 09:30 to 16:00, and after 19:00) . Accurate ticket prices vary depending on the time of day, route, and class selected.
